Common Solar Panel Installation & Repair Scams in Pioneertown

Be aware of these tactic used by unlicensed operators

🚫

Fake Rebate Scams

Scammers door-knock promising huge 'government rebates' or 'free panels' that don't exist. They take a deposit and disappear.

🚫

Upfront Payment Traps

Insist on full or large payment before any work starts, then ghost or do shoddy work.

🚫

Bait-and-Switch Installations

Quote cheap Tier 2/3 panels, then swap for inferior ones or skip proper permitting.

🚫

Phantom Crew Vanish

Start work with a small crew, take payments, then never return to finish.

How to Verify a Professional

1

Insurance

Ask for a certificate of insurance covering general liability and workers' compensation. Call the insurer to confirm it's current.

2

Licensing

Search the contractor's license number on cslb.ca.gov. In California, legit solar installers hold a C-10 Electrical or C-46 Solar license from the Contractors State License Board.

3

References

Request 3 recent local references in San Bernardino County. Contact them and check reviews on BBB.org, Yelp, and Google.

Protection FAQs

What licenses do solar installers need in California?

Look for C-10 (Electrical Contractor) or C-46 (Solar Contractor) on cslb.ca.gov. Verify active status and any complaints.

Are door-to-door solar sales legitimate?

Often not. Legit companies rarely door-knock aggressively. Research independently instead of signing on the spot.

Should I pay upfront for solar panels?

No—limit to 10-20% deposit. Pay in stages: after design, permit, install, inspection.

How do I verify solar incentives for Pioneertown?

Check energy.ca.gov for state programs and sgip.ca.gov for rebates. Local utility (e.g., Southern California Edison) confirms net metering.

What if a solar company pressures me to sign now?

Walk away. California law gives a 3-day right to cancel door-to-door contracts—use it.

How to check if solar panels are high quality?

Ask for Tier 1 modules (BloombergNEF list). Demand 25-year warranties and performance guarantees.
